According to http://gcc.gnu.org/install/specific.html#mips-sgi-irix6,
GNU as from GNU binutils 2.15 or later is required for debugging with
the O32 ABI. I'm building GCC 4.0.2 as follows:
$ cd /opt/build
$ bzip2 -dc /opt/src/devel/gcc-4.0.2/src/gcc-4.0.2.tar.bz2 | tar xf -
$ mkdir gcc
$ cd gcc
$ /opt/build/gcc-4.0.2/configure --with-included-gettext \
--enable-shared --enable-threads --enable-languages="c,c++"
$ gmake bootstrap
...
checking assembler for COMDAT group support... no
checking assembler for COMDAT group support... no
checking linker -Bstatic/-Bdynamic option... no
checking assembler for explicit relocation support... yes
*** This configuration requires the GNU assembler
Bootstrapping the compiler
I don't really care about O32 but --disable-multilib disables O32 and
N64. Is the GNU assembler requirement above because O32 support is
enabled by default?
